Number of days when at least one drink of alcohol was used in past month (TA16)

Data file: Women

Overview

Valid: 10070
Invalid: 3387
Type: Discrete
Decimal: 0
Start: 662
End: 663
Width: 2
Range: 0 - 30
Format: Numeric

Warning: these figures indicate the number of cases found in the data file. They cannot be interpreted as summary statistics of the population of interest.
Interviewer instructions
If respondent did not drink, circle “00”.
If less than 10 days, record the number of days.
If 10 days or more but less than a month, circle “10”
If “everyday” or “almost every day”, circle “30”.
